Description

3-(4-Fluorophenyl)-5(4H)-Isoxazolone CAS NO 31709-51-0 is a versatile heterocyclic building block characterized by its fused isoxazolone and fluorinated phenyl rings. This compound matters for its role as a key synthetic intermediate in the development of advanced pharmaceuticals and agrochemicals, where its unique structure enables the creation of molecules with targeted biological activity. It is primarily needed by research and development chemists, process development scientists, and manufacturers in the pharmaceutical, agrochemical, and fine chemical industries.

Basic Information

Item Detail
Product Name 3-(4-Fluorophenyl)-5(4H)-Isoxazolone
CAS No. 31709-51-0
Molecular Formula C9H6FNO2
Molecular Weight 179.15 g/mol
Synonyms 5(4H)-Isoxazolone, 3-(4-fluorophenyl)-; 3-(p-Fluorophenyl)-5(4H)-isoxazolone; 4-Fluoro-β,3-dioxobenzeneethanamine, N-hydroxy-; 3-(4-Fluorophenyl)-4,5-dihydro-1,2-oxazol-5-one; 4-Fluorophenylisoxazolone; p-Fluorophenylisoxazolone; 31709-51-0 (CAS)

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(typically 15-25°C). Keep away from strong oxidizing agents and strong bases. For long-term storage, consider an inert atmosphere to maintain product integrity.
